Transaction 348008941b28b0c71a0fc6fc25995954e09c9aea91cb7c217a9c735e8aecaf7a

1 Input
2 Outputs
  • 348008941b28b0c71a0fc6fc25995954e09c9aea91cb7c217a9c735e8aecaf7a:0
  • value  306024
    address  3Ez6t1QWV5bACer36R7AFRGbFiKYCkVBCF
  • 348008941b28b0c71a0fc6fc25995954e09c9aea91cb7c217a9c735e8aecaf7a:1
  • value  2849936
    address  1MfYsQHGnYf5hWAK9QpWSeqgXzZaKk39ox